ABOUT THE ARTIST
Shlomo Mintz is the 2021/22 Ong Teng Cheong Professor in Music at the YST Conservatory. He served as Distinguished Artist-in-Residence in the 2018 Singapore International Violin Competition. Considered by colleagues, audiences, and critics one of the foremost violinists of our time, Shlomo Mintz has long been acclaimed as a celebrated guest artist with many of the great orchestras and conductors on the international stage and continues to enchant audiences with his playing.
Awarded with many prestigious international prizes among others, the Diapason D’Or, the Grand Prix du Disque, the Gramophone Award and the Edison Award, in 2006 he received an Honorary Degree from the Ben-Gurion Universit, (Beersheba, Israel). He regularly gives masterclasses worldwide and is invited by the most prestigious international competitions.
